The Texas Scottish Rite Hospital Dyslexia Training Program (DTP) was developed by the Texas Scottish Rite Hospital in Dallas as a response to the need to provide dyslexia intervention in schools throughout Texas and around the world.  The DTP introduces reading and writing skills to students through a two-year cumulative series of videotaped lessons.  The program emphasizes intense phonetic analysis of written language and is presented in a structured, multisensory sequence of alphabet, reading, spelling, cursive handwriting, listening, language history, and review activities.
